Canon announces two new PowerShot cameras

Canon has definitely been busy preparing new products. Today, they did not just announce a new HD camcorder, but also two new digital cameras to expand even more their PowerShot line-up. The new PowerShot S5 IS and PowerShot SD850 IS are both digital ELPH cameras which share some features like a DIGIC III image processor Optical Image Stabilization (OIS), Face Detection technology and an 8.0 megapixel resolution. Besides these similarities these cameras are very different, the PowerShot S5 IS is a full size camera with a 12x optical zoom lens, while the SD850 IS is an ultra-compact model with a 4x lens.

The S5 will retail for $499.99 and will be available the first days of July, 2007. The SD850 will be $399.99 and you can expect it to hit stores mid-June.
